- Summary
- Rouben Ter-Arutunian (1920-1992) was a scenic and costume designer best known for his long association with the New York City Ballet. The design portfolios are a comprehensive reflection of the artist's prolific forty-year career designing for theater, ballet, dance, opera, television, and motion picture productions. The portfolios are made up of materials mostly gathered together under a production's title and contain set and costume designs; set models; press material; photographs; design notes; technical drawings; business documentation; correspondence; and research and reference material.

- Source (note)
- Purchased by the Jerome Robbins Dance Division from Rouben Ter-Arutunian in 1989. In 1995, a framed scenic design from Pelleas et Melisande was gifted to the Jerome Robbins Dance Division by William Crawford. In 1996, a framed scenic design from The Devils of Loudun was gifted to the Jerome Robbins Dance Division by William Crawford. In 1990, five set pieces from Four Saints in Three Acts were donated to the Jerome Robbins Dance Division by the Opera Ensemble of New York.
- Location of Other Archival Materials (note)
- The Rouben Ter-Arutunian papers, Jerome Robbins Dance Division, The New York Public Library, (S)*MGZMD 277. The Rouben Ter-Arutunian papers contain personal and professional materials from his forty-year career as a designer. The collection holds address books, contracts, correspondence, datebooks, design files, exhibit materials, family papers, notebooks, photographs, scrapbooks, slides and writings.
